Alright....lets start off with a rough draft
A. Source Material 1. A Stephen King Adaptation 2. An Edgar Allen Poe Adaptation 3. An HP Lovecraft Adaptation B. Language of Origin 4. A Spanish Language horror film 5. A French Language horror film 6. An Asian Language horror film 7. An Eastern European/Slavic Language horror film C. Time Period 8. A Classic Creature Feature (30's-50's) 9. A Gothic Horror Tale (40's-60's) 10. The B-List Killer/Slasher (70's-80's) 11. A Sex Thriller (80's-90's) 12. A Revival/Remake/Throwback (00's-10's) D. The Players(Actors/Actresses/Directors/Producers) 13. A Brian De Palma/William Castle/Wes Craven film 14. A Linnea Quigley/Jamie Lee Curtis/Barbara Steele film 15. A Peter Cushing/Vincent Price/Christopher Lee film 16. A Lucio Fulci/Dario Argento/Mario Bava film 17. A Alfred Hitchcock/Terence Fisher/Christopher Smith film 18. An A24/Blumhouse/Roger Corman/Hammer/Universal film E. Distributor 19. A Rotten Horror Film from Rotten Tomatoes 20. A Fresh Horror Film from Rotten Tomatoes 21. A Horror Film on Shudder 22. A Horror Film on Hulu 23. A Horror Film on Amazon 24. A Horror Film on Netflix 25. A Horror Film from 2020 F. Genre 26. A Werewolf Film 27. A Vampire Film 28. A Ghost/Haunted House Film 29. A Witchcraft/Satanic Film 30. A Frankenstein's Monster Film 31. A Zombie Film |
